Nakamori is an absolute hidden gem. It doesn't look great from the outside - the sign is old and faded, the wooden tables inside and out are plain and the ambiance in general leaves quite a bit to be desired. However, if you are looking for excellent Japanese food at a truly amazing price, you can't get much better than this.My husband and I went for dinner, and we started with sushi. The tempura california roll and eel maki were excellent - fresh ingredients, well made and very generous with the good stuff (as compared to some sushi places that give mostly rice with a touch of the fish/filling). We went on to have Chicken Yakitori that was tender and full of flavor.For a main, I had the tempura udon which was a huge portion and beautifully prepared and presented, while he had the katsudon donburi, which he said was also delicious and looked beautiful in the box it was presented in.All that food (we were stuffed), plus a couple beers and a cool drink came to just under R300. Highly recommend for anyone who wants REAL Japanese food (instead of Chinese food and sushi like some restaurants). We will definitely be going there again soon.
Very traditional and authentic Japanese food. This place doesn't serve Chinese food in addition to Japanese, as many Japanese (and Chinese) places in Johannesburg do. They stick to the classic Japanese cuisine. The sushi is fresh and of excellent quality and they make a range of traditional teppanyaki dishes. The authenticity of the food here is attested to by how many Japanese come to eat here---its always a good sign when an ethnic cuisine is supported by the ethnicity it represents. The prices are sensationally reasonable. My only criticism of this place is that the chairs are hard. But otherwise, come to Nakamori and enjoy Japanese food the way they enjoy it in Japan. So try it out; you might just find that it becomes your go-to place for sushi and the other culinary delights of Japan.
